How Chemical Scrubbers Work
The Science Behind the Solution
Chemical scrubbers, also known as wet scrubbers, use a liquid solution (often water combined with chemicals) to neutralize odorous gases. Here’s how it works:
- Capture: Odorous air is drawn into the scrubber.
- Contact: The air passes through a packed bed or spray chamber, where it comes into contact with the scrubbing liquid.
- Neutralization: Chemicals in the liquid react with and neutralize odorous compounds, converting them into harmless byproducts.
- Release: Clean air is discharged into the atmosphere.
Common Applications
Chemical scrubbers are highly effective for:
- Wastewater treatment plants (removing hydrogen sulfide, ammonia, and mercaptans)
- Pulp and paper mills (controlling sulfur compounds and VOCs)
- Food processing facilities (eliminating organic odors)
- Industrial manufacturing (handling acidic or alkaline gases)

The Benefits of Chemical Scrubbers
1. High Efficiency
Chemical scrubbers can achieve removal efficiencies of 95% or higher for target contaminants, making them one of the most reliable odor control technologies available.
2. Versatility
Unlike some odor control methods, chemical scrubbers can handle a wide range of pollutants, including:
- Acidic gases (e.g., hydrogen sulfide, sulfur dioxide)
- Alkaline gases (e.g., ammonia)
- Soluble VOCs (volatile organic compounds)
